- [ ] **Step 7: Breaker override escrow.** After sealing the signing keys for the Tallgrove upstream API circuit breaker, confirm the support team can force the breaker open during a full outage. The override bundle lives in the sealed escrow drawer and is useless without its unlock phrase. Two ceremony witnesses must initial this step before proceeding. The escrow bundle is decrypted with the recovery passphrase that follows.

vault phrase of kahip-kahop = holath-quenmir

Hey plugin folks — heads up that the staging credential for the Moorhatch migration runner expired last night, which is why your zero-downtime schema migrations have been stuck at the "shadow table" phase. Nothing's broken with your plugins; the runner just couldn't auth to apply the backfill step, so it paused safely mid-migration. We've minted a fresh credential and re-queued everything. If you run migrations locally against the staging gateway, swap out the old value and use the replacement key below.

service key, fawip-bajef: kto11_Qt5wZK9vdNC

Rotated signing key for the Ovenlark order-cutoff service. Prior key retired after the 14:00 cutoff rule shipped; old key signed the pre-cutoff config bundles only. On-call: configs signed before rotation remain valid until the Thistledown bakery batch window closes. Reject any new cutoff-rule bundle signed with the retired key — page platform if one appears. Verification script is `ovenlark-verify`, unchanged. Cache invalidation not required; verifiers pull keys live. New deployments must validate against the replacement key, included below.

deploy key for yajop-fahop: bky3_h1v